Job Summary

Responsible for providing technical and operational assistance during surgical procedures and other medical interventions by ensuring the availability and proper functioning of anesthesia equipment and supplies, preparing and maintaining the operating room environment, and assisting in the delivery of safe and effective anesthesia care.

Patient Care Required: Yes

Essential Functions

  • Ensure anesthesia carts are supplied and machines are in each room prior to the beginning of the surgery schedule and between procedures
  • Check and replace anesthesia gas tanks as needed
  • Retrieve special anesthesia supplies that are anticipated and/or requested by the person administering the anesthetic before and during surgery
  • Prepare complex equipment and supplies for hemodynamic monitoring
  • Ensure monitoring equipment and supplies are ready
  • Ensure the anesthesia machine is ready for use including troubleshooting and correcting problems
  • Perform daily anesthesia equipment inspections including suction, electrical plugs, gas connections, oxygen and nitrous oxide cylinders

Case Pick Responsibilities

  • Collect sterile supplies in specific quantities as specified by the patient-specific Preference Card, inspecting each product for expiration and package integrity
  • Collect sterile instrument sets and peel packs in specific quantities as specified by the patient-specific Preference Card, inspecting each product for indications of appropriate sterilization and package integrity including wrap and sterilization tape integrity, and presence of external locks
  • Select empty Case Carts that are appropriate for the amount of sterile product needed and ensure the Case Cart is clean and free of soil and debris
  • Using SPM, build Case Carts for assigned surgical cases
  • Scan all instruments and supplies to the Case Cart
  • Scan the Case Cart to appropriate Operating Room and/or storage locations
